The sport box was one of two in the MkII Escort. Slightly heavier duty than the standard and slightly taller gears. I actually have one of each, doing nothing at the moment. I used the Sport one with my 1700 Crossflow w/o problems. I just wanted a cruise gear so fitted a Type 9. And this added quite a lot of weight... Sounds like the 'Sport box' Robin very good for free , but not very strong. Anything over 100 bhp and it don't like it, I had one in a Dutton once with a 1600 crossflow putting out about 125bhp. It lasted six months ! A very generous offer though.
